ansible_ipa_replica: Fix ansible-test fake execution test findings

All imports that are only available after installing IPA need to be in a
try exception clause to be able to pass the fake execution test. The old
workaround "if 'ansible.executor' in sys.modules:" is not working with
this test anymore.

If the imports can not be done, all used and needed attributes are
defines with the value None.

The new function check_imports has been added to fail with module.fail_json
if an import exception occured and ANSIBLE_IPA_REPLICA_MODULE_IMPORT_ERROR is
not None. This function needs to be called in all modules.

The `copyright` date is extended with `-2022`.
